TCN-Driven Volatility-Robust Forecasting in Minute-Resolution Cryptocurrency Markets

Abstract

This paper proposes Temporal Convolutional Networks (TCNs) for cryptocurrency forecasting at minute-resolution. TCNs show better accuracy to XGBoost, LightGBM, and LSTM. However, TCNs are less robust than the tree models regarding volatility. While TCNs require much more computations at inference than LightGBM, they run faster than LSTMs. The performance of TCNs is best configured using a TCN with dilated convolutions to capture the temporal patterns, and with residual connections for the stability.
